THE ULTIMATE SLEEPER RETURNS! One of my favorite project cars of all time - the Turbo Hayabusa swapped smart car that stole ...
ThatDudeInBlue takes a 300HP turbo Hayabusa-swapped Smart Car for the ultimate tuner troll drive. Bruce Willis’s wife makes ‘hardest decision’ to move star out of family home as his condition worsens ...